Testosterone Booster Supplements Market size was worth USD 4.5 billion in 2026 and is poised to grow at a 9.88% CAGR between 2027 and 2036, attaining USD 11.55 billion by 2036. The industry revenue for 2027 is assessed at USD 4.87 billion.

The testosterone booster supplements market was led by North America, which held a 42.51% share in 2026. The region benefits from established consumer awareness of sports nutrition, wellness products, and dietary supplementation, creating a favorable environment for testosterone-support formulations. Growing interest in active lifestyles, fitness, strength training, and healthy aging is encouraging consumers to seek products associated with energy, physical performance, and overall vitality. Well-developed retail and e-commerce channels also provide broad access to supplements, while greater consumer attention to ingredient transparency and product quality is supporting demand for specialized formulations. These factors collectively reinforce North America’s strong market position.

Herbal-based supplements accounted for a 47.7% share of the testosterone booster supplements market in 2026, supported by strong consumer interest in plant-derived ingredients and wellness-oriented formulations. Herbal ingredients are widely associated with natural health benefits, making them attractive to consumers seeking alternatives to conventional supplementation. Growing awareness of fitness, vitality, and healthy aging is also supporting demand for formulations positioned around natural approaches to hormonal wellness.

Capsules/Tablets led the testosterone booster supplements market with a 58.59% share in 2026, reflecting their established position as convenient and familiar formats for dietary supplementation. These formats support straightforward dosing, efficient storage, and incorporation of diverse ingredient combinations, making them suitable for consumers following regular supplementation routines. Their broad acceptance across the nutritional supplement industry and established manufacturing infrastructure continue to reinforce their leading position.
